
Britannia Industries Limited (NSE: BRITANNIA, BSE: 500825) has announced that Rajneet Singh Kohli, Executive Director and Chief Executive Officer, has resigned from his position to pursue an opportunity outside the company. His resignation is effective as of the close of business hours on March 14, 2025.
The Board of Directors noted Mr. Kohli’s resignation today, March 6, 2025, via a circular resolution. Mr. Kohli submitted his resignation on March 5, 2025, citing personal reasons in his resignation letter (enclosed as Annexure-I in the company filing).
T. V. Thulsidass, Company Secretary of Britannia Industries Limited, confirmed the CEO’s departure in a filing with the stock exchanges.
Rajneet Singh Kohli’s departure marks the end of his tenure as CEO of Britannia Industries. The company will now begin the process of identifying a successor to lead the organization forward.

Crackdown on Electricity Theft
The Chamundeshwari Electricity Supply Corporation Limited (CESC) Vigilance Team has imposed fines totaling ₹6.36 crore on individuals illegally tapping power across Mysuru, Chamarajanagar, Mandya, Kodagu, and Hassan districts. So far, ₹5.94 crore has been recovered.
